Storm window replacement services involve removing outdated or damaged storm windows and installing new units to improve a building’s insulation and protection. This process typically includes assessing the existing storm windows, selecting appropriate replacements that match the property’s needs, and ensuring proper installation for optimal performance. The goal is to enhance energy efficiency by reducing drafts and heat loss, while also safeguarding windows against harsh weather conditions.

These services address common problems such as drafts, cold spots, and increased energy bills caused by inefficient or broken storm windows. They can also help prevent water infiltration, which might lead to wood rot or interior damage. Replacing storm windows can contribute to a more comfortable indoor environment and extend the lifespan of the primary windows by providing an additional barrier against the elements.

Storm window replacement is often sought by property owners of residential homes, especially those with older or historic structures where original windows are still in use. Commercial buildings, multi-family residences, and institutional properties may also benefit from these services, particularly in climates with significant seasonal temperature fluctuations. The right storm windows can improve overall building performance and reduce maintenance needs over time.

Material and Window Size Costs - The cost to replace storm windows varies based on material choices and window dimensions. Typically, prices range from $150 to $400 per window, with larger or custom-sized units costing more. Local pros can provide specific estimates based on project details.

Labor and Installation Expenses - Installation costs depend on the number of windows and complexity of the project. Expect labor charges to range from $50 to $150 per window, which may be included in the overall project estimate. Contact local service providers for precise pricing.

Additional Features and Upgrades - Upgrading to energy-efficient or specialty storm windows can increase costs. These enhancements might add $50 to $200 per window, depending on the features selected. Local contractors can advise on available options and pricing.

Project Scope and Customization - Costs can vary significantly based on the scope of work and customization needs. For a complete storm window replacement in High Ridge, MO, prices typically range from $600 to $2,000 for multiple windows. Local pros can assist in providing tailored quotes.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What are storm windows? Storm windows are additional window panels installed on the exterior or interior of existing windows to provide extra insulation and protection against the elements.

How do I know if my storm windows need replacing? Signs that storm windows may need replacement include difficulty opening or closing, drafts, condensation between panes, or visible damage like cracks or warping.

What types of storm window replacement options are available? Replacement options include full-frame replacements, insert storm windows, and custom-fit panels designed to match existing window styles.

How long does storm window replacement typically take? The duration varies based on the number of windows and the chosen method, but many installations can be completed within a day or two.
